The IMB’s Piracy Reporting Centre has just released details of an incident on Sunday off the Omani coast.
According to the report, pirates armed with guns in two skiffs approached an LPG tanker underway in position 25.15N-057.16.4E at 1516 UTC, approximately 48nm off Fujairah, Oman. The Master fired warning flares and pyrotechnics, increased speed and manoeuvred in order to keep the skiffs right astern.
UKMTO and navies in vicinity informed. An Iranian warship responded and escorted the tanker until clear of the skiffs. This is likely to be the same incident mentioned by Iranian Press sources on Monday. As the SW monsoon makes small boat operations in the GoA more difficult, it is likely that this type of incident will continue. The proximity to one of the regions larger ports is, however, a concern.
